Here Are The 10 Finalist Shots For The Bird Photographer Of The Year 2022
Since its first edition in 2015, the Bird Photographer of the Year (BPOTY) competition has been keen to highlight and reward the most beautiful bird photographs in order to raise awareness and raise funds for their protection. So while waiting for the announcement of the winners on September 8, the organizers of the famous competition unveiled the finalists for the 2022 edition a few days ago.
For this 7th year of competition, more than 20,000 shots immortalized by amateur and professional photographers of all ages from 115 countries were received. The sumptuous shots of birds often overlooked in their natural habitat were decided by a jury made up of professionals. The key: the title of Best Bird Photographer of the Year, the sum of 5800 euros, and the publication of his photos in the BPOTY 2022 book.
